What are Captains Chairs?


Captains chairs, also known as bucket seats, are individual front seats that are separated by a center console. This configuration provides a more spacious and personalized seating experience compared to a traditional bench-style front seat. Captains chairs often include additional features such as adjustable lumbar support, heating and cooling functions, and integrated armrests for enhanced comfort and convenience.

Is the 4Runner changing in 2024?


The 4Runner's last major refresh was ten model years ago. The sole new addition to the 2024 Toyota 4Runner lineup is a new paint color. Terra, which is an orange-brown, will be offered on the TRD Pro trim.

Is the 2025 4Runner bigger than the 2024?


Design Differences Between the 2024 and 2025 4Runner Models
The 2025 4Runner has a more muscular stance and a new frame adopted from the Toyota Tacoma. As a result, the wheelbase is now 2.4 inches longer. The 2025 4Runner maintains similar ground clearance at 9.2 inches but is an inch shorter than the 2024 SUV.
